基于dram的可重構(gòu)邏輯的制作方法
【專利說明】基于DRAM的可重構(gòu)邏輯
[0001]對相關(guān)申請的交叉引用
[0002]本申請要求在2014年12月16日提交的題目為“DRAM-BASED RE⑶NFIGURABLELOGIC”、序列號為62/092,819的美國臨時專利申請的優(yōu)先權(quán)。通過引用將該早先提交的申請的主題合并于此。
[0003]本申請要求在2014年12月16日提交的題目為“HBM WITH DRAM-BASEDRECONFIGURABLE LOGIC ARCHITECTURE”、序列號為62/092,822的美國臨時專利申請的優(yōu)先權(quán)。通過引用將該早先提交的申請的主題合并于此。
[0004]本申請要求在2014年12月16日提交的題目為“SPACE-MULTIPLEXINGDRAM-BASEDRECONFIGURABLE LOGIC"、序列號為62/092,825的美國臨時專利申請的優(yōu)先權(quán)。通過引用將該早先提交的申請的主題合并于此。
技術(shù)領(lǐng)域
[0005]該說明書涉及計算技術(shù),并且更具體地涉及可重構(gòu)的處理單元。
【背景技術(shù)】
[0006]通常,可編程邏輯設(shè)備(PLD)是用于構(gòu)建可重構(gòu)的數(shù)字電路的電子組件。與通常具有固定功能的邏輯門或邏輯電路不同,傳統(tǒng)地PLD在制造的時候具有未定義的功能。往往,在能夠在電路中使用PLD之前,必須將其編程,S卩,重新配置以執(zhí)行期望的功能。
[0007]傳統(tǒng)地,PLD可以包括邏輯設(shè)備和存儲設(shè)備的組合。通常,存儲器用于存儲在編程期間對芯片給出的模式。用于將數(shù)據(jù)存儲在集成電路中的大多數(shù)方法已經(jīng)適用于PLD。這些方法通常包括硅反熔絲、靜態(tài)隨機存取存儲器(SRAM)、可擦除可編程序只讀存儲器(EPR0M)、電EPROM(EEPROM)、非易失性RAM,等等。通常,大多數(shù)PLD包括通過在芯片內(nèi)部的硅的修改區(qū)域上施加異常水平的電壓而被編程的組件。該高電平的電壓破壞或設(shè)置(取決于技術(shù))電氣連接并且改變電子電路的布局。
[0008]PLD的最常見類型之一是現(xiàn)場可編程門陣列(FPGA) TPGA是被設(shè)計為在制造之后由顧客或設(shè)計者配置的集成電路一一因此是“現(xiàn)場可編程的”。通常使用與用于專用集成電路(ASIC)的語言類似的硬件描述語言(HDL)來規(guī)定FPGA配置。
[0009]FPGA包括可編程邏輯塊的陣列和允許塊“被用布線連接在一起”的可重構(gòu)的互連的分級體系。FPGA的邏輯塊能夠被配置為執(zhí)行復(fù)雜的組合功能,或者僅僅執(zhí)行簡單的邏輯門,像AND、XOR等等。
【發(fā)明內(nèi)容】
[0010]根據(jù)一個一般方面,一種裝置可以包括存儲陣列,該存儲陣列包括多個存儲子陣列。子陣列中的至少一個可以被布置為可重構(gòu)查找表。該可重構(gòu)查找表可以包括:被配置為存儲數(shù)據(jù)的多個存儲單元;局部行譯碼器,被配置為基于輸入信號的集合來激活存儲單元的一個行或多個行;局部線選擇器,被配置為基于至少一個輸入信號來選擇存儲單元的行的子集。
[0011 ]根據(jù)另一個一般方面,一種裝置可以包括處理器,該處理器包括被配置為執(zhí)行邏輯功能的固定的邏輯電路。處理器可以被配置為:將數(shù)據(jù)存儲在動態(tài)隨機存取存儲陣列的存儲單元中;將被配置為執(zhí)行邏輯功能的查找表存儲在動態(tài)隨機存取存儲陣列的可重構(gòu)查找表中;以及將邏輯功能的執(zhí)行卸載到通過動態(tài)隨機存取存儲陣列所包括的可重構(gòu)查找表。
[0012]根據(jù)另一個一般方面,一種方法可以包括:由處理器經(jīng)由第一存儲器存取將第一查找表寫入到動態(tài)隨機存取存儲陣列的可重構(gòu)查找表的子陣列。該方法也可以包括:由可重構(gòu)查找表并且響應(yīng)于由處理器進行的第二存儲器存取來執(zhí)行第一邏輯操作。該方法可以包括:由處理器經(jīng)由第三存儲器存取將第二查找表寫入到動態(tài)隨機存取存儲陣列的可重構(gòu)查找表的子陣列。該方法可以另外包括:由可重構(gòu)查找表并且響應(yīng)于由處理器進行的第四存儲器存取來執(zhí)行第二邏輯操作。
[0013]在附圖和以下描述中闡述一個或更多個實施方式的詳情。根據(jù)描述和附圖并且根據(jù)權(quán)利要求,其他特征將是明顯的。
[0014]本方面涉及一種用于計算技術(shù)的系統(tǒng)和/或方法,并且更具體地涉及可重構(gòu)的處理單元,基本上如至少一個圖中所示的和/或與至少一個圖結(jié)合所描述的,如在權(quán)利要求中更完全地闡述的。
【附圖說明】
[0015]圖1是根據(jù)所公開的主題的系統(tǒng)的示例實施例的框圖。
[0016]圖2a是根據(jù)所公開的主題的裝置的示例實施例的框圖。
[0017]圖2b是根據(jù)所公開的主題的裝置的示例實施例的框圖。
[0018]圖2c是根據(jù)所公開的主題的裝置的示例實施例的框圖。
[0019]圖3是根據(jù)所公開的主題的裝置的示例實施例的框圖。
[0020]圖4是可以包括根據(jù)所公開的主題的原理所形成的設(shè)備的信息處理系統(tǒng)的示意性框圖。
[0021]在各個圖中的相同附圖標記指示相同的要素。
【具體實施方式】
[0022]將參考示出一些示例實施例的附圖來在下文中更充分地描述各種示例實施例。然而,可以以許多不同的形式來體現(xiàn)目前所公開的主題,并且目前所公開的主題不應(yīng)當被理解為限于在本文闡述的示例實施例。確切地講,提供這些示例實施例使得本公開將是徹底的和完備的,并且將向本領(lǐng)域技術(shù)人員全面?zhèn)鬟_目前所公開的主題的范圍。在附圖中,可能為了清楚而夸大層和區(qū)域的尺寸和相對尺寸。
[0023]將理解的是,當要素或?qū)颖环Q為是“在另一個要素或?qū)由稀?、“連接到”或“耦合到”另一個要素或?qū)訒r,其能夠直接地在另一個要素或?qū)由?、連接或耦合到其他要素或?qū)?,或者可以存在居間要素或?qū)印O喾?,當要素被稱為“直接在另一個要素或?qū)由稀?、“直接連接到另一個要素或?qū)印被颉爸苯玉詈系搅硪粋€要素或?qū)印保瑒t不存在居間要素或?qū)?。貫穿本文,類似的?shù)字指代類似要素。如在這里所使用的,術(shù)語“和/或”包括一個或多個相關(guān)所列項的任何一個或所有組合。
[0024]應(yīng)當理解,盡管術(shù)語第一、第二等等在本文可以用于描述各個要素、組件、區(qū)域、層和/或部分,但這些要素、組件、區(qū)域、層和/或部分不應(yīng)該受這些術(shù)語的限制。這些術(shù)語僅用于將一個要素、組件、區(qū)域、層或者部分與另一個區(qū)域、層或部分相區(qū)別。因此,以下討論的第一要素、組件、區(qū)域、層或部分可以被稱為第二要素、組件、區(qū)域、層或部分,而不會背離目前所公開的主題的教導。
[0025]在本文為了便于描述可以使用諸如“在...之下”、“低于”、“低”、“在...上方”、“上”等等的空間相對術(shù)語,來描述一個要素或者特征與另一個要素(多個)或者特征(多個)的關(guān)系,如圖中所圖示的。將理解的是,空間相對術(shù)語意圖包括除圖中描繪的定位之外的、在使用或操作中的設(shè)備的不同的定位。例如,如果圖中的設(shè)備被翻過來,則描述為“低于其他要素”或“在其他要素之下”的要素將被定位為“在其他要素或者特征上方”。因此,示例性術(shù)語“低于”能夠包括在...上方和低于的定位兩者。設(shè)備可以以另外方式被定位(旋轉(zhuǎn)90度或者處于其他定位)并且在本文使用的空間相對描述符相應(yīng)地進行解釋。
[0026]在本文使用的術(shù)語僅用于描述特定實施例的目的,并且不意圖限制目前所公開的主題。如在這里所使用的,單數(shù)形式“一”、“一個”和“該”也意圖包括復(fù)數(shù)形式,除非上下文清楚地另外指出其他。應(yīng)當進一步理解,當術(shù)語“包括”和/或“包括在內(nèi)”在本說明書中使用時,指定所陳述的特征、整數(shù)、步驟、操作、要素和/或組件的存在,但不排除存在或另外有一個或多個其他的特征、整數(shù)、步驟、操作、要素、組件和/或其的分組。
[0027]在本文參考作為理想化示例實施例(和中間結(jié)構(gòu))的示意圖示的截面圖示來描述示例實施例。照此,將預(yù)計作為例如生產(chǎn)工藝和/或公差的結(jié)果所引起的從圖示的形狀所發(fā)生的變化。因而,示例實施例不應(yīng)當被理解為受限于在本文所圖示的區(qū)域的特定形狀,而是包括例如由制造引起的形狀的偏差。例如,圖示為長方形的植入?yún)^(qū)域典型地將在其邊緣具有圓形的或彎曲的特征和/或植入濃度的梯度,而不是具有從植入?yún)^(qū)域到非植入?yún)^(qū)域的二元改變。同樣地,通過植入所形成的隱埋區(qū)可能引起隱埋區(qū)和通過其植入發(fā)生的表面之間的區(qū)域中的一些植入。因而,在圖中圖示出的區(qū)域?qū)嶋H上是示意的并且它們的形狀并不意圖圖示出設(shè)備的區(qū)域的實際的形狀并且并不意圖限制目前所公開的主題的范圍。
[0028]除非另外